It's not POSSIBLE to get that kind of scores in 3DMark2k1 with MX using default settings. No way. The resolution is 640x480, 16 bit colors, 16 bit textures, 16 bit z-buffer... I just ran it at those and I got 4194, with ALL quality-enhancements enabled with GTU & RivaTuner.
I get ~2750 with the default settings. My MX is clocked @ c205/m215.
